摘  要:测定5种生物农药对预蛹期松毛虫赤眼蜂(Trichogramma dendrolimi Matsumura)和成蜂的毒力并进行安全性评价。结果表明,预蛹期赤眼蜂对这些生物农药的敏感性较成蜂低,其中苏云金芽孢杆菌对预蛹期赤眼蜂的毒力最小,安全系数最高。其他试剂毒力从大到小依次为苦参碱、百部·川楝·苦参碱、斜纹夜蛾核型多角体病毒、棉核·苏云菌。建议在使用赤眼蜂寄生卵卡时,在出蜂前喷施苏云金芽孢杆菌。Toxicity and safety evaluation of five biological pesticides to Trichogramma dendrolimi Matsumura were investigated. The results showed that the sensitivity of the pesticides to the pre-pupa T. dendrolimi was lower than that of adult T. den- drolimi. The toxicity of Bacillus thuringiensis to the pre-pupa T. dendrolimi was the lowest, and the safety coefficient of Bacillus thuringiensis to the pre-pupa T. dendrolimi was the highest. The order of toxicity from high to low was matrine, stemonine, melia toosendan · matrine, nuclear polyhedrosis viruses and Bacillus thuringiensis. It is suggested that spraying Bacillus thuringiensis before emergence when using parasitized egg cards of Trichogramma dendrolimi in the field.
